What Is Acrylic Pouring?
Acrylic pouring is a painting technique that involves mixing acrylic paints with a pouring medium and then pouring the mixture onto a canvas or other surface. The result is beautiful, abstract designs that often feature vibrant colors and interesting patterns. Each piece created with this method is unique, making it a popular choice for both beginners and experienced artists.
How Does Acrylic Pouring Work?
Acrylic pouring paints are specially formulated to have a fluid consistency, allowing them to flow easily across the canvas. Here’s how it typically works:
- Choosing Your Colors: Start by selecting a palette of acrylic paints. You can use any colors you like, but many artists choose a mix of complementary and contrasting hues for a more dynamic effect.
- Mixing the Paints: To create the right consistency for pouring, you’ll need to mix your acrylic paints with a pouring medium. This medium helps the paint flow smoothly and reduces the risk of cracking as it dries. Follow the instructions on the pouring medium for the best results.
- Pouring Techniques: There are several techniques you can use when pouring acrylics, such as the flip cup, dirty pour, or puddle pour. Each technique creates different effects, so feel free to experiment and find what you like best.
- Creating Your Artwork: Once your paints are mixed, it’s time to pour! Pour the paint onto the canvas in layers or patterns, allowing it to flow and blend together. You can tilt the canvas to help the paint spread or use tools like straws or palette knives for additional effects.
- Finishing Touches: After your artwork dries, consider applying a clear varnish or sealant to protect it and enhance the colors. This step will give your piece a beautiful, glossy finish.
Tips for Getting Started
Here are some helpful tips for beginners interested in acrylic pouring:
- Practice: Don't worry about making a perfect piece on your first try. Experiment with different colors, techniques, and surfaces to discover what works best for you.
- Use Quality Materials: Investing in good-quality acrylic paints and pouring mediums can make a significant difference in the final result. Look for products specifically designed for pouring.
- Work in a Controlled Environment: Acrylic pouring can be messy, so set up your workspace with protective coverings. Have plenty of paper towels or rags on hand to clean up spills.
- Be Patient: Allow your artwork to dry completely before handling it. Drying times can vary, so be sure to read the instructions for your specific materials.
